A revered preceptor, scholar, and visionary, Swami Ramanuja was a profound philosopher and social reformer, embodying nobility and greatness. His immeasurable contribution as the guardian and redeemer of Sanathana Dharma, the Vedic way of life, enriched our understanding of the Lord and the universe. He gifted humanity a scriptural treasure and democratized the “Prapathi Marga”—the path of complete surrender with unwavering love and devotion—making its essence accessible to all, regardless of caste, gender, or creed. This book offers a visual journey through the life and times of Swami Ramanuja, the preceptor of the Universe, through exquisite Tanjore paintings. This pictorial tribute aims to foster an understanding of his greatness, his glorious life, and the enduring relevance of his teachings.
